#02ff2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#02ff2e is composed of 0.8% red, 100%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 82%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 130.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 50.4%. #02ff2e color hex could be obtained by blending #04ff5c with #00ff00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

Shades and Tints of #02ff2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#edfff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#02ff2e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#778a7a is the less saturated color, while #02ff2e is the most saturated one.
